SECTION V SPECIFICATIONS
SPECIFICATIONS
All items of work performed under this project shall be completed according to the latest
Pennsylvania Department of Transportation 408 Specifications, unless otherwise specifically stated.
0350-0121 SUBBASE (NO. 2A) (for BASE REPAIR)
This work consists of the placement of 2A subbase for base repair or minor shoulder widening. For this
project consider as incidental to this item the excavation and removal of up to 12 inches of existing pavement or
shoulder material. Ensure the area is compacted and place 6 inches of 2A subbase and 4 inches of binder course.
Also incidental all joints are to be sealed with an approved crack sealer prior to overlay.
This item will be paid for at the contract unit price per ton of 2A placed for base repari including the sealing
of all joints. Binder course will be paid by tons as indicated below.

0460-0002 BITUMINOUS TACK COAT
This work shall consist of the conditioning and treating of the existing pavement surface with an application
of bituminous bonding material at a rate of 0.07 gal/s.y. as specified in the Pennsylvania Department of
Transportation Specifications, Publication 408. (PG 64-22)
This item will be paid for on a material used price per gallon. Line items to separate roads, parks, and public
work areas are established for tracking purposes.
0491-0032 MILLING OF ASPHALT PAVEMENT SURFACE, 1 1/2" DEPTH, MILLED MATERIAL
RETAINED BY COUNTY (DELIVERED TO STOCKPILE) - PUBLIC ROADS
0491-0034 MILLING OF ASPHALT PAVEMENT SURFACE, 2 1/2" DEPTH, MILLED MATERIAL
RETAINED BY COUNTY - PUBLIC WORKS SALT SHED
This work consists of the milling of one and one-half (1½) inches or two and one-half (2½) inches of the
existing bituminous surface, using a milling machine, to the width and length as shown on the plans. The milled
material will be the property of the County, but will also be used as the material for the shoulder backup . Any
existing wedge curbs are to remain in place and not be milled unless they are deteriorated to the point of requiring
reconstruction. This will be determined at the initial project walk-through.
These items will be paid for at the contract unit price per square yard. Line items to separate roads,
and public work areas are established for tracking purposes.
4350-0121 SHOULDER BACKUP /DRIVEWAY ADJUSTMENTS WITH MILLED MATERIAL
PROVIDED FROM MILLINGS GENERATED BY PROJECT
This work shall consist of the placement and compaction of millings to be used as a shoulder backup and if
necessary driveway adjustments not being done with asphalt. Use milling from the project
This item will be paid for at the contract unit price per ton.

0962-0001 PAINTING TRAFFIC LINES – 4” LINES YELLOW AND WHITE
0960-0026 24" WHITE HOT THERMOPLASTIC TRANSVERSE PAVEMENT MARKINGS 0960-0140 WHITE HOT THERMOPLASTIC PAVEMENT LEGEND TRAFFIC SIGNAL
STRAIGHT/LEFT, RIGHT
WATERBORNE PAVEMENT MARKINGS
This work shall consist of simultaneously applying two 4 inch yellow parallel lines spaced 4 inches apart at
a wet-film thickness of 15 mils + 1 mil along with automatically dispensing glass beads at a rate of 7 pounds per
gallon of paint onto the painted surface by a pressurized glass-gun. Also, right and left 4 inch white edge lines shall
be applied at a wet film thickness of 12 mils± 1 mil along with glass beads at a rate of 7 pounds per gallon. All
materials and workmanship shall be in accordance with Section 962-Waterborne Pavement Markings PA DOT
Publication 408 (current edition), including reflectometer measurements.
This item will be paid for at the contract unit price per linear foot of line applied. Lines will be painted after
paving and a second time after installation of the center line rumble strip.
TRAFFIC PAVEMENT MARKINGS
This work is the furnishing and installation of hot thermoplastic pavement lines, markings, and legends of
the indicated type and color shown on the drawings with a surface application of glass beads. All material and
workmanship shall be in accordance with Section 960-Hot Thermoplastic Pavement Markings PA DOT form
408/latest edition.
This item will be paid for at the contract unit price per linear foot of line applied and the contract unit price
each legend applied.
RETROREFLECTIVITY
The contractor will be responsible for conducting retroreflectivity sampling in accordance with PA. Test
Method No. 431. A PTM-431 Documentation Form must be furnished for each individual road that is painted.
This item will be considered incidental to the contract unit price
0492-0001 DRIVEWAY ADJUSTMENTS
In some, but not all areas, the overlay will required transition from the paved shoulder or edge of the lane to
the existing driveway is to be of material the same or equal to the existing driveway material. Paved driveways and
lots requiring transition /adjustment must have a 2 ft. (min.) transition joint cut to a 1-1/2 inch depth to tie the
wearing surface into the driveway or lot. All pavement joints must be sealed with AC-20. The stone and
bituminous material needed for each driveway adjustment will be included for payment under the paving and
shoulder backup items. The lump sum payment for this item will include milling drives, sealing joints, and
additional labor needed to adjust driveways. Each driveway will need to be reviewed prior to resurfacing
operations

0901-0001 MAINTENANCE & PROTECTION OF TRAFFIC DURING CONSTRUCTION
This work consists of the maintenance and protection of traffic adjacent to and within the work area covered
by this contract, in accordance with Section 901 of the Pennsylvania Department of Transportation Publication 408,
and Publication 213.
The work on these areas will require advance scheduling for coordination with the affected parties. For the
work areas these conditions apply
Twin Lakes Park (main roads and pavilion access/parking) – coordinate with Engineer and Park staff as not
to conflict with any park events prior to establishing schedule. County Park staff will block off areas of
work in advance of the days necessary.
District Justice Office - coordinate with Engineer to confirm suitable schedule, must not conflict with court
operations.
Public Works Salt Shed – Coordinate with Engineer for suitable days/access.
Roads – Industrial Park and Nature Park - Coordination for the roads will also be necessary to ensure access
for industrial, institutional, and retail establishments along both roads.
It is the responsibility of the contractor to furnish, install, and maintain all traffic control signs and devices
and provide the necessary flagmen needed in order to maintain one unrestricted traffic lane for alternate two-
directional traffic around the work areas during working hours. The alternate two-directional traffic pattern will be
established in accordance with the 67 PA Code, Chapter 212. The contractor should restrict the length of the
alternate two-directional traffic movement to that length which is required to effectively perform construction
operations. During all phases construction vehicular and pedestrian access to all business and residences must be
maintained. It will be the contractor's responsibility to maintain a constant surveillance of the traffic control
operations and correct anything found ineffective to provide a safe and efficient flow of traffic during construction.
This item will be paid for as a lump sum.
